The race theory is German fascism’s theoretical axis. In fascist ideology the economic programme of the so-called twenty-five points figures solely as an expedient intended ‘to improve the Germanic race genetically and to protect it against racial interbreeding’ which, according to the National Socialists, always entails the decline of the ‘higher race’. Indeed, it is their contention that even the decline of a culture is to be traced back to miscegenation. Hence, ‘keeping the blood and the race pure’ is a nation’s noblest task, in the fulfilment of which one must be prepared to make any sacrifice. In Germany and the German-occupied countries, no means were spared in putting this theory into practice in the form of the persecution of the Jews.
The race theory proceeds from the presupposition that the exclusive mating of every animal with its own species is an ‘iron law’ in nature. Only exceptional circumstances, such as captivity, are capable of causing a violation of this law and of leading to racial interbreeding. When this occurs, however, nature revenges itself and uses every means at its disposal to oppose such infringements, either by making the bastard sterile or by limiting the fertility of later offspring. In every crossbreeding of two living creatures of different ‘levels’, the offspring will of necessity represent something intermediate.
But nature aims at a higher breeding of life; hence bastardization is contrary to the will of nature. Natural selection also takes place in the daily struggle for survival, in which the weaker, i.e., racially inferior, perish. This is consistent with the ‘will of nature’, for every improvement and higher breeding would cease if the weak, who are in the no majority, could crowd out the strong, who are in the minority. Hence, nature subjects the weaker specimens to more severe conditions of life as a means of limiting their number; on the other hand, it does not allow the rest to multiply indiscriminately; they are subjected to a ruthless selection on the basis of energy and health.
The National Socialist went on to apply this supposed law in nature to peoples. Their line of reasoning was something as follows: Historical experience teaches that the ‘intermixing of Aryan blood’ with ‘inferior’ peoples always results in the degeneration of the founders of civilization. The level of the superior race is lowered, followed by physical and mental retrogression; this marks the beginning of a progressive ‘decline’.
The North American continent would remain strong, Hitler states, ‘as long as he [the German inhabitant] does not fall a victim to defilement of the blood that is to say, as long as he does not interbreed with non-Germanic peoples.
‘To bring about such a development is, then, nothing else but to sin against the will of the eternal creator.’ These views are unmistakably mystical; nature’ regulates’ and’ wills’ ‘according to reason’. They are the logical culmination of biological metaphysics.
According to Hitler, humanity is to be divided into three races: the founders of civilization, the upholders of civilization and the destroyers of civilization. Only the Aryan race is considered as the founder of civilization, for it built the ‘foundation and walls of human creation’. The Asian peoples, the Japanese18 and the Chinese, for example, merely took over the Aryan civilization and translated it into their own form. Thus, they are upholders of civilization.
The Jewish race, however, is a destroyer of civilization. The existence of ‘inferior human beings’ is the chief prerequisite for the establishment of a higher civilization. Man’s first civilization rested upon the use of inferior human races. In olden times it was the vanquished who were made to pull the plow, which only much later was pulled by the horse. As conqueror, the Aryan subjugated the inferior masses and regulated their activity in accordance with Aryan needs to compass Aryan ends. However, as soon as the subjugated peoples began to learn the language and to adopt the customs of the ‘masters’, and the clear-cut demarcation between master and slave was obliterated, the Aryan relinquished the purity of his blood and lost ‘his sojourn in paradise’. Through this, he also lost his cultural genius. We are not forgetting that Adolf Hitler represents the flowering of civilization.
Blood mixture and the resultant drop in the racial level is the sole cause of the dying out of old cultures; for men do not perish as a result of lost wars, but by the loss of that force of resistance which is contained only in pure blood.

An objective and technical refutation of this basic idea is out of the question here. It borrows an argument from Darwin’s hypothesis of natural selection, some elements of which are as reactionary as his proof of the origin of species from lower organisms is revolutionary. Moreover, this idea conceals the imperialist function of fascist ideology. For if the Aryans are the sole founders of civilization, then, by virtue of their divine destiny, they can lay claim to world dominion. And, in fact, one of Hitler’s principal claims was the expansion of the borders of the German empire, especially ‘towards the East’, i.e., into Soviet Russian territory. Thus, we can see that the glorification of an imperialist war lay wholly within the compass of this ideology.

Here we are solely interested in the irrational origin of these ideologies, which, objectively viewed, were in conformity with the interests of German imperialism; most of all we are interested in the contradictions and incongruities existing in the race theory. Race theorists who refer to a biological law in support of their theory overlook the fact that racial breeding of animals is an artefact. It is not a question whether dog and cat have an’ instinctive aversion’ to interbreeding, but whether collie and greyhound, German and Slav, have the same aversion.
Race theorists, who are as old as imperialism itself, want to achieve racial purity in peoples whose interbreeding, as a result of the expansion of world economy, is so far advanced that racial purity can have a meaning only to a numbskull. We do not want to enter into the other absurdities here - as if racial circumscription and not its opposite, promiscuous mating within the same species, were the rule in nature.
In the present examination we are not concerned with the rational content of the race theory, a theory that, instead of proceeding from facts to valuations, proceeded from valuations to a distortion of the facts. Nor will arguments be of any use against a fascist who is narcissistically convinced of the supreme superiority of his Teutonism, if only because he operates with irrational feelings and not with arguments. Hence, it would be hopeless to try to prove to a fascist that black people and Italians are not racially ‘inferior’ to the Teutons. He feels himself to be ‘superior’, and that’s the end of it.
The race theory can be refuted only by exposing its irrational functions, of which there are essentially two: that of giving expression to certain unconscious and emotional currents prevalent in the nationalistically disposed man and of concealing certain psychic tendencies. Only the latter function will be discussed here. We are especially interested in the fact that Hitler speaks of ‘incest’ when an Aryan interbreeds with a non-Aryan, whereas it is usually sexual intercourse among those who are related by blood that is designated as incest.
